Jenna Levy / Gallup:
In U.S., Uninsured Rate Dips to 11.9% in First Quarter  —  Story Highlights  —  WASHINGTON, D.C. — The uninsured rate among U.S. adults declined to 11.9% for the first quarter of 2015 — down one percentage point from the previous quarter and 5.2 points since the end of 2013, just before the Affordable Care Act went into effect.

Rebecca Shabad / The Hill:
US military spending drops as other regions boost defenses  —  U.S. military spending fell by 6.5 percent last year as other countries increased their spending on defense, according to a report released Monday by the Stockholm International Peace Research Institute.
Washington Post:
Four Blackwater guards sentenced in Iraq shootings of 31 unarmed civilians  —  A federal judge in Washington handed down prison terms of 30 years to life behind bars to four Blackwater Worldwide guards convicted in a deadly 2007 shooting that killed 14 unarmed Iraqis and injured others in a Baghdad traffic circle.
